Good things to know
Which word is more common?
Acceleration is more common than quickening in technical or scientific contexts, while quickening is more common in everyday language.
What’s the difference in the tone of formality between acceleration and quickening?
Acceleration is generally considered more formal than quickening, which can be used in both formal and informal contexts.
